The posting of the Proposed Assessment Report is an important step in developing a drinking water source protection plan for the Essex Region Source Protection Area. Included in the Source Protection Area are the municipal water systems of Windsor (A.H. Weeks WTP), Amherstburg, Belle River, Essex (Harrow-Colchester WTP), Pelee Island, Stoney Point, Union WTP (Ruthven), and Wheatley.
The Proposed Assessment Report includes:
- The identification of vulnerable areas associated with municipal drinking water sources
- The types of activities which would be considered threats in those vulnerable areas
- Water quality issues associated with the raw (untreated) water to municipal drinking water system which could be addressed through source protection planning
- A water budget which assesses areas where the quantity of water available may be stressed
- General background material which might be useful in the upcoming development of the Source Protection Plan
